So many romantic comedies condense the action into one night or one weekend, says Tamar Jeffers McDonald, the author of the BFI Film Classics guide to When Harry Met Sally One of the amazing and audacious things about this one is that it gives the characters time to mature and see other people and make their mistakes. In most romcoms, the prospective lovers are kept apart by living in different cities (Ephrons own Sleepless in Seattle) or different countries (Four Weddings and a Funeral). According to the Random House Historical Dictionary of American Slang, it was When Harry Met Sally that popularized the term high-maintenance in American culture. During the trip, they discuss aspects of their characters and their lives, eventually deciding it is impossible for men and women to be "just friends." But the films true innovation is the way its director, Rob Reiner, and screenwriter, Nora Ephron, strip away the characters biographical details, just as they clear away all the obstacles on their path to happiness. When we originally thought of this film, it was just going to be men and women talking about men and women, and that dance that happens before you finally wind up with each other., The idea occurred to Reiner because his first marriage (to actor-director Penny Marshall) had ended, and he had returned reluctantly to bachelor life.
